In World War 1 America stayed out until near the end, and Britain which owned about 70 per cent of American industry had to sell most of it off to get the resources to help beat the German threat to Europe. In World War 2 the UK also had to face Germany alone and had to sell off its remaining US assets to sustain its war effort until the US joined the effort two years later.

So America gained pre-eminent economic power in the world, which enabled it to dominate the developed world and spread its culture via the emerging electronic media.

Why is American English so influential around the world?

American English is influential globally due to the economic, political, and cultural dominance of the United States. The country's popular culture, technology, and media have all played a role in spreading American English worldwide. Additionally, the widespread use of English as a global lingua franca has further solidified the influence of American English.

How did Native American culture reflect the resources available to these groups?

Native American culture developed around the resources available to them. For instance, plains culture was nomadic, as they followed the buffalo herds. Pueblo culture was stationary due to the ability to engage in agriculture.
